Crear un modelo de factura automática en Excel — guía paso a paso

Evaluez cet article !
[Total: 0 Moyenne : 0]


Crear un modelo de factura automática en Excel — guía paso a paso

¿Quiere ahorrar tiempo automatizando la facturación sin invertir en un software costoso? Excel sigue siendo la herramienta más accesible para diseñar un modelo de factura personalizado y eficiente. Este artículo le guía, paso a paso, desde la estructura visual hasta las fórmulas y macros que transforman una hoja en un generador de facturas listo para usar. Sin excusas: siguiendo estas prácticas obtendrá un documento fiable, reutilizable y fácil de adaptar a la evolución de su actividad.

En resumen

🧾 Estructura clara: separe los bloques « empresa », « cliente », « líneas de facturación » y « totales ». Un modelo bien segmentado facilita la lectura y la automatización.

⚙️ Fórmulas clave: use SUMPRODUCT, VLOOKUP/XLOOKUP y formatos condicionales para calcular montos, impuestos y descuentos sin errores manuales.

🔒 Seguridad y exportación: proteja las celdas críticas, bloquee el diseño y exporte en PDF mediante una macro o la opción nativa de Excel.

🚀 Escalabilidad: conecte sus listas de productos o clientes mediante un CSV o Power Query para generar automáticamente facturas a partir de un catálogo.

1. Planificar el modelo: contenido y objetivos

Antes de abrir Excel, defina qué debe contener su factura: identificación del emisor (nombre, SIRET/IVA intracomunitario), datos del cliente, fecha y número de factura, líneas (descripción, cantidad, precio unitario), posibles descuentos, tasa de IVA, total sin impuestos, importe de IVA y total con impuestos incluidos. Esta etapa evita idas y vueltas y limita la complejidad de las fórmulas. También piense en los usos: impresiones en papel, envío por correo electrónico, archivo digital — cada uno impone diferentes elecciones de maquetación.

2. Construir la maquetación

2.1 Encabezado y datos

Cree una zona de encabezado donde figuren el logo, el nombre de la empresa y los datos de contacto. Coloque la información legal (SIRET, RCS, IVA intracomunitario) en forma de texto compacto. Use tamaños de fuente distintos para jerarquizar visualmente: logo + nombre en grande, datos legales en pequeño. Para un resultado limpio, combine algunas celdas solo para el encabezado y mantenga la cuadrícula de las líneas de factura estandarizada.

2.2 Bloque cliente e información de factura

A la derecha del encabezado, prevea un bloque cliente (nombre, dirección, contacto) y justo al lado el bloque « Factura » que contenga Número, Fecha y Vencimiento. La numeración debe ser automática: veremos un método simple un poco más abajo. Mantenga estos campos aislados para enlazarlos fácilmente con macros o fórmulas que creen facturas a partir de un modelo maestro.

3. Tabla de líneas: estructura y fórmulas

La tabla de líneas es el núcleo funcional: debe permitir entrada manual o selección mediante listas desplegables, calcular automáticamente los montos y permitir descuentos. Aquí las columnas recomendadas:

  • Referencia / Código de producto
  • Descripción
  • Cantidad
  • Unidad
  • Precio unitario sin IVA
  • % Descuento
  • Importe sin IVA (calculado)
  • Tasa de IVA
  • Importe IVA (calculado)
  • Importe con IVA (calculado)

3.1 Fórmulas prácticas

Aquí algunas fórmulas recomendadas, a adaptar según la ubicación real de las columnas:

Objetivo Ejemplo de fórmula Comentario
Importe sin IVA (con descuento) =Quantité * PrixUnitaire * (1 - Remise%) Reemplace los nombres por las celdas correspondientes; use referencias absolutas para las columnas de precios.
Importe IVA =MontantHT * TauxTVA Si IVA 20%: TasaIVA = 0,20. Prefiera listas de tasas si se usan varios valores.
Importe con IVA =MontantHT + MontantTVA O =MontantHT*(1+TauxTVA) para ir más rápido.
Totales generales =SUM(ColMontantHT) y =SUM(ColMontantTVA) Calcule por separado sin IVA, IVA y con IVA para mayor transparencia.

4. Numeración automática y datos dinámicos

La numeración suele ser el punto delicado: desea un número único, secuencial y no reutilizado. Dos enfoques:

  • Usar una celda simple que se incremente manualmente: menos automatización pero muy fiable si genera una factura a la vez.
  • Usar una macro VBA que lea el último número registrado (en una pestaña «Historial» o un archivo externo) y lo incremente automáticamente en cada generación. Es la solución más profesional si exporta facturas con frecuencia.

En la mayoría de los casos, un pequeño archivo Excel «base» que contenga el último número es suficiente: la macro lo abre en modo lectura/escritura y actualiza el valor tras la creación. Si prefiere mantenerse 100% sin macros, puede vincular el número a la fecha (ej: AAAAMM-001) e incrementar manualmente el sufijo.

5. Importar productos o clientes (CSV, Power Query)

Si dispone de un archivo que lista sus productos o clientes, es más robusto extraer la información de allí en lugar de reingresar manualmente. Para ello, puede importar un archivo CSV y luego normalizar los datos (separadores, codificación, formatos numéricos) para alimentar listas desplegables o búsquedas mediante XLOOKUP. Power Query, integrado en Excel moderno, automatiza la importación y limpia el archivo manteniendo una conexión actualizable; es la opción ideal para catálogos que evolucionan.

6. Validación, listas desplegables y búsqueda de elementos

Para limitar errores, cree listas desplegables (Datos > Validación de datos) para el código de producto y la tasa de IVA. Luego asocie una función XLOOKUP o INDEX/MATCH para completar automáticamente la descripción y el precio unitario cuando se elija el código de producto. Este método reduce incoherencias y acelera la entrada de datos.

7. Formato y protección

Cuide el formato: bordes discretos, alineación numérica a la derecha y color de fondo ligero para las celdas modificables. Bloquee las celdas que contienen fórmulas y deje en edición solo los campos destinados a la entrada (cantidad, selección de producto, observaciones). Para ello, desbloquee las celdas necesarias (Formato > Bloqueo), luego proteja la hoja con contraseña si es necesario.

Ejemplo de modelo de factura automatizada en Excel

Ficha de imagen

El visual arriba muestra una factura compacta con encabezado, bloque cliente, tabla de líneas y zona de totales. Puede adaptar los colores a su carta gráfica respetando una jerarquía legible entre información legal y datos numéricos.

8. Generar un PDF y archivar

Para enviar una factura por correo electrónico, la exportación en PDF es imprescindible. Puede usar Archivo > Exportar > Crear un PDF/XPS, o automatizar el proceso mediante una macro que exporte la zona imprimible y nombre el archivo según la convención de numeración. Para el archivo, guarde el PDF en una carpeta estructurada (ej.: /Facturas/2025/MM/) y recuerde guardar metadatos (cliente, número, monto) en una pestaña «Historial» para facilitar búsquedas posteriores.

9. Opción avanzada: usar una macro para generar la factura

Una macro puede:

  • verificar los campos obligatorios,
  • incrementar la numeración,
  • crear un PDF en la carpeta objetivo,
  • registrar la entrada en la pestaña Historial.

Si no es desarrollador VBA, comience grabando una macro que haga la exportación a PDF y luego examine el código para configurarlo (nombres de archivos, rangos de impresión). Incluso una macro simple es suficiente para industrializar la creación.

10. Buenas prácticas y verificaciones

  • Conserve una pestaña « Historial » inmutable para evitar duplicados de números.
  • Pruebe su modelo con varios escenarios: descuentos, múltiples tasas de IVA, decimales, redondeos.
  • Documente el uso para sus colaboradores: campos a rellenar, botones a usar, ubicación de los archivos.
  • Automatice las copias de seguridad regulares y limite los derechos de edición en la hoja modelo.

Ejemplos rápidos de fórmulas y trucos

Algunos trucos finos:

  • Use TEXT para formatear la fecha en la numeración: =CONCAT(TEXT(TODAY(),"yyyymm"),"-",TEXTE(Numéro,"000")).
  • Prefiera XLOOKUP (o INDEX/MATCH si versión anterior) para búsquedas robustas: =XLOOKUP(Code;TableProduits[Code];TableProduits[Prix]).
  • Para redondear el IVA correctamente, use ROUND a 2 decimales en los cálculos intermedios.

FAQ

P: ¿Cómo automatizar la numeración sin VBA?
R: Puede almacenar el último número en una pestaña e incrementarlo manualmente, o usar una combinación de fecha + contador diario para minimizar riesgos de duplicados.

P: ¿Puedo enviar la factura automáticamente por email desde Excel?
R: Sí, mediante una macro que adjunte el PDF generado y envíe un correo vía Outlook. Atención a la seguridad y a los parámetros de su correo.

P: ¿Debo conservar la factura en formato Excel?
R: Se recomienda archivar el PDF para la integridad legal, y mantener un registro cliente/número en un archivo maestro para el historial.

En práctica: lista de verificación antes del primer envío

  • Probar cada fórmula con valores límite (cantidades 0, descuentos 100%, IVA 0%).
  • Verificar el diseño impreso (vista previa antes de imprimir).
  • Proteger las celdas sensibles.
  • Realizar una copia de seguridad completa del archivo modelo.

Recursos rápidos

Para importaciones regulares de listas de productos o clientes, descubra los métodos de importación y corrección de un archivo CSV para evitar errores de codificación o formato que distorsionen sus tarifas y búsquedas.

FAQ detallada

  • ¿Cómo gestionar varias tasas de IVA? : Cree una columna « Tasa IVA » en la tabla de líneas y úsela para calcular el IVA línea por línea. Luego sume los montos por tasa si es necesario para las declaraciones.
  • ¿Se pueden generar varias facturas en lote? : Sí, mediante una macro o vinculando Excel a fuentes vía Power Query e iterando sobre el archivo fuente para producir PDFs distintos.
  • ¿Se necesita un modelo diferente para los presupuestos? : Puede reutilizar la misma estructura adaptando algunas etiquetas y añadiendo un estado (Presupuesto/Factura) si desea conservar la unicidad de los documentos.

Evaluez cet article !
[Total: 0 Moyenne : 0]
Lire aussi  SUMAR.SI y SUMAR.SI.CONJUNTO en Excel: sumar con condiciones
Julie - auteure Com-Strategie.fr

Julie – Auteure & Fondatrice

Étudiante en journalisme et passionnée de technologie, Julie partage ses découvertes autour de l’IA, du SEO et du marketing digital. Sa mission : rendre la veille technologique accessible et proposer des tutoriels pratiques pour le quotidien numérique.

Deja un comentario